Marinated Chicken Kebabs with Cucumber and Yogurt Salad

We’re set for the hottest weekend so far this year, which means many of you will be lighting up the barbeque and enjoying some al fresco fun!  So, we thought we’d share one of our favourite recipes ideal for outdoor grilling, which is simple, tasty and will impress all your family and friends!

Serves 4-6

Prep and Cooking Time – 55 minutes

Ingredients:

125g plain yogurt

490g plain yogurt

2 Cloves Garlic, crushed

1 tbsp fresh ginger, grated

1 tsp garam masala

1 tsp ground turmeric

2 tsp lemon zest, plus 2 tbsp lemon juice

Salt and pepper

750g skinless chicken breast, diced

Oil for grill grates

 

Method:

1 Combine the yogurt, garlic, ginger, garam masala, turmeric, lemon zest and juice, and ½ teaspoon each of salt and pepper in a bowl. Add the chicken and stir to coat all the meat. Let marinate for 15 minutes, then thread onto six large metal or soaked wood skewers.

 

2 Once your barbecue has reached temperature, grill the skewers, turning occasionally, until the chicken is cooked through and tender – around 8-10 minutes.

 

3 Serve with grilled flatbreads and Cucumber and Yogurt Salad.

Cucumber and Yogurt Salad

Prep Time – 10 minutes

This simple but tasty side salad goes so well with these marinated chicken skewers, as well as many other barbecued delights including lamb koftes and burgers.

Ingredients:

375g cup plain yogurt

½ cucumber, seeded and cut into slim one-inch batons

1 spring onion, finely sliced

1 handful coriander, chopped

Salt and pepper to taste

 

Method:

 1 Combine the yogurt, cucumber, spring onion, coriander. Stir Well and season to taste with salt and pepper.
